Description of the issue: I purchased the A2A Comanche 250 via MSFS2020 Market Place during the latest sale. When I chose the 250 in MSFS 2024, the PMS GTN 750 is too dark in the daytime. I cannot use the A2A hotfix because I did not purchase directly from A2A, so the GTN 750 remains too dark during the day.

This is not just an A2A problem. Cowansim helis have this issue as well as the default DC-3. the 750 is way too dark in daytime and bright at night. In the GNS 530, its too dark at night and bright in daytime. Exact opposite.

Something is dimming the avionics too much.
